Rarities in Numeral Systems

We present an extensive survey of rare structural properties in numeral systems in the world's languages, foremostly the question of rare number bases. The survey emphasizes comprehensiveness and status of evidence.

Rarities in ocular sarcoidosis.

OCULAR involvement in sarcoidosis is both varied and frequent (Longcope and Freiman, 1952). The incidence is about 30 to 40 per cent. (Levitt, 1941; Woods and Guyton, 1944; Gifford and Krause, 1949; Longcope and Freiman, 1952).
